NRS 692C.3546: Applicability of confidentiality provisions to NAIC and third parties.

Documents, materials or other information in the possession or control of the NAIC or a third-party consultant in accordance with the provisions of NRS 692C.351 to 692C.3548, inclusive, are:

1. Confidential by law and privileged;

2. Not subject to the provisions of chapter 239 of NRS;

3. Not subject to subpoena; and

4. Not subject to discovery or admissible in evidence in any private civil action.
